Linköping - Vreta Abbey
11km/7mi northwest of Linköping, on the road to Motala, stands Vreta Abbey, a 13th century church (restored 1920) which belonged to a house of Cistercian nuns. On the north side of the church, which contains numerous monuments, are the foundations of the conventual buildings and the cloister.
Passengers cruising from Stockholm to Göteborg have time for a visit to Vreta Abbey (about 20 minutes), southeast of the canal, while the boat is passing through the locks.
